The Dirndl: A garment with history and future

Before we dive into the styling tips, it's worth taking a look at the roots of this iconic garment. Originating in the 19th century as workwear in Alpine regions, the dirndl developed into an integral part of Bavarian identity from the 1950s onwards. Today, it's experiencing a renaissance – not only during the Oktoberfest season, but also on the streets, in offices, and cafés.

Material matters

In the Dirndl Sale you will often find elegant evening models, but for everyday wear we recommend:

  • Cotton with elastane (freedom of movement)
  • Linen blends (breathability)
  • Stretch twill (shape stability)
